What Happens When You Deactivate Your Account?

Before you proceed, it’s helpful to know what to expect. When you choose to deactivate your account, your profile essentially goes into hibernation. Most of your information becomes invisible to other people on Facebook. Your name will be removed from your friends’ lists, and people won’t be able to search for you. However, some data, like messages you’ve already sent, may remain visible. Crucially, this process is reversible. Your photos, posts, and friends are all preserved, waiting for you if you decide to return.

A Step-by-Step Guide on How to Delete FB Account Temporarily

Taking this step is straightforward. First, click the arrow in the top right corner of any Facebook page and select Settings & Privacy, then click Settings. From the left-hand menu, choose Your Facebook Information. Here, you will find the option for Deactivation and Deletion. Select this, and you’ll see two choices. Make sure to pick Deactivate Account. Facebook will then ask for your reason and may present you with a few options, like pausing Messenger or receiving email notifications. Once you’ve made your selections, enter your password and confirm your choice.

Tips for a Smooth Social Media Break

To make your time away truly restful, consider a couple of extra steps. If you use Facebook to log in to other apps or websites, you might want to update your login method for those services beforehand. Also, it can be a good idea to download a copy of your Facebook data for your own records. You can find this option in the same Your Facebook Information section. This gives you peace of mind, knowing your memories are safely stored with you.
